Answer:

x= 4

Step-by-step explanation:

Whenever you are solving a variable, you need it by itself (isolate for x)

-6 + x/4 = -5

Move the -6 to the right

x/4 = -5 +6

Simplify

x/4= 1

Multiply by 4

x= 4 x 1

x = 4

Don't forget if you are ever not sure just plug in your answer to check
